My cat's automatic litter box recently stopped working and it's around 300$ for a replacement which we were thinking of doing. I thought I could take a look at it and see if I could try to fix it. I initially thought the motherboard traces were corroded and not making contact so I tried to reflow the solder but no luck. The motherboard and microcontroller pre-installed had no documentation or help guides other than contacting the company to buy a replacement. I decided to try if I can use a Wemos D1 Mini ESP8266 microcontroller to control it, and after many hours (6) later I present to you a polarity switching circuit using 3 SPDT relays, a step-down buck converter to convert the 18V power from the built-in power on the cat litter to 12V the relays could use. Then after a lot of trial and error I found the perfect transistor (2N2222) in my transistor kit to convert the 3.3v logic levels from the ESP8266 to the 12v or something that the relays can use. Some of my trouble could be avoided if I used the correct DPDT relay modules meant for this, but this is all I had on hand. It's not quite finished since I still need to hook up the 2 sensors and 2 end stops to make it safe of course, but it's coming along and now the hard part is down. In the end, I'm going to open source a schematic design and order a PCB to contain everything.

Eeeiii! First #scrapbook post. With the help of the sweetest, smartest co-workers here at HQ, I’ve been building a Slack cat bot in js using Bolt. I started by roughing out a design that is vastly beyond my current abilities, and that is based on the worst funniest personality traits of my IRL cat. github.com/karamassie/madcatbot A Cat currently lives in #the-litter-box only. It’s very shy, for now. So far, I’ve learned how to: • set up a bot using Slack’s API • use Replit; and then, • get my Slack tokens revoked by accidentally moving all my code to a public repo in GitHub • regenerate those, and put them in a non-uploaded file • Run my bot locally On the js side I’ve learned how to: • Set up which channel it is in • Get the bot to respond to certain words or phrases • Set up delays and randomization • Create ‘untriggered’ events (ie the bot does random things without provocation) • Have the bot react to users entering the channel

:nodejs: api-pathmaker is a module(ish?) that I made to write less code when you’re implementing an API in Node.js. It lets you model the request in object format and then make the request without having to define everything with an http library. I made it because I was tired of having to use a random API just for a few requests (for example, getting cat pictures) and the API doesn’t have a library, but you still want clean code. It’s kind of a mini-ship and it’s part of a larger project I’m making. GitHub & Download: github.com/yodaLightsabr/api-pathmaker

YESS!!! I finally deployed my sad cats API (ScaaS) to my Oracle Cloud Instance's public IP, I had to learn about Ingress rules, IPTABLES and ufw. I've failed so many times trying to do this oof. But seriously if I had figured out how to do it early, I wouldn't be able to learn so much! (But seriously I should've read oracle cloud's docs at first lol)
